U.S. Stocks Turning In Lackluster Performance As Early Buying Interest Fades WASHINGTON (dpa-AFX) - Stocks showed a strong move to the upside at the start of trading on Thursday but have subsequently settled into the lackluster trend seen over the past few sessions. The major averages have pulled back well off their highs are once again lingering near the unchanged line. Currently, the major averages are turning in a mixed performance. While the Nasdaq is down 7.39 points or 0.1 percent at 14,043.64, the Dow is up 25.09 points or 0.1 percent at 33,845.47 and the S&P 500 is up 10.39 points or 0.3 percent at 4.193.57. The Nasdaq and the S&P 500 initially rose to new record intraday highs in reaction to upbeat earnings news from tech giants like Apple (AAPL) and Facebook (FB).
